Card Bot

Description: this is a bot written in python in an attempt to get more cards in the hands of everyday users.(US Only) NOTE: THIS WILL NOT AUTO BUY, THIS IS FOR ALERT USE ONLY!

Currently Working:

  • Best Buy

In Planning:

  • NewEgg
  • Amazon
  • Stopping reoccurring emails on in stock products that you have been alerted on already.

Planned for next release:

  • Making sure you are not re-alerted for the exact same item multiple times within the same stock period.

How To Get Up and Running

Step 1: Clone this project to your desired directory.
Step 2: Navigate to that directory and run the following:

#It is recommended that you run this in a virtual enviornment,
pip install -r requirements.txt

Step 3: Create a Best Buy developer account, and obtain an API key from them.
Step 4: Make a new (or use your current one) Gmail. We will use this Gmail to notify you via email/text. YOU WILL NEED TO ALLOW LESS SECURE APPS. FOLLOW THIS LINK This is why I recommend you use a separate email account from your own. Step 5: Fill out the config_example.ini and rename to config.ini

[COMMON]
APIKEY = <this is the bestbuy api key>
EMAILADDRESS = <the email address you are using to notify you of instock cards>
EMAILPW =<password to the above email address>
NOTIFYCONTACT=<the number you want to text>

When texting from an email you need to use the handle correspondent to your cell service provider. The are as follows: Verizon Wireless: @vtext.com AT&T: @txt.att.net T-Mobile: @tmomail.net Inside BestBuyScan.py, look for the following text commend

#Replace Code Here

and replace the message variable with the following:

message = f"""\
Subject: CARD FOUND
Card: {w[c].json()["products"][j]["name"]}
URL: {w[c].json()["products"][j]["url"]}"""

NOTE: MAKE SURE YOU FOLLOW THE SAME FORMATTING, OTHERWISE EMAIL WILL NOT PROPERLY SEND. THIS WILL BE FIXED IN THE NEXT RELEASE!
